SummaryTwo four-story masonry buildings in Williamsburg, with stoops and broken pediments over rounded entrance arches; sign in English over parlor floor at left reads, "Belzer Yeshiva, Machzikei Torah of Belz"; same sign in Hebrew over parlor floor at right; Hasidic man walking on street in foreground; overhanging leaves and branches at top.
